Split aptamer mediated endonuclease amplification for small-molecule detection.

Qing Li1, Yan-Dan Wang, Guo-Li Shen, Hao Tang, Ru-Qin Yu, Jian-Hui Jiang.   

Abstract

A novel, highly sensitive split aptamer mediated endonuclease amplification strategy for the construction of aptameric sensors is reported.
